How to Convert Milliliter to Ounce

1 milliliter = 0.033814 ounces

Ounce = Milliliter × 0.033814

Example: 102 mL × 0.033814 = 3.449 fl oz

Reverse Conversion

To convert ounces back to milliliters:

  • Remember, 1 ounce equals 29.5735 milliliters.
  • To convert 3.449 fl oz to mL, multiply 3.449 x 29.5735, resulting in 102 mL.
